Watched Hong Kong sprouting sky scrapers using only bamboo scaffolding in the 70’s & 89’s. Coolies clambering up the poles to lash the next one on. Mind boggling.
Used to live in Hong Kong and yes, the bamboo scaffolding is amazing. But they do use cross bracing. One tie, in the industrial building where I worked, it was necessary to do some repairs between an adjacent building, about the 14th floor. What do they do? Cut some bamboo around one foot longer than the gap and wedge it in place until they have a wedged platform on which to work.
